CAS 1117-66-4
:Ethyl 7-aminoheptanoate
Description:
Ethyl 7-aminoheptanoate, with the CAS number 1117-66-4, is an organic compound that belongs to the class of amino acids and esters. It features a heptanoic acid backbone with an amino group (-NH2) located at the seventh carbon, and an ethyl ester functional group. This compound is typically a colorless to pale yellow liquid or solid, depending on its purity and temperature. Ethyl 7-aminoheptanoate is soluble in polar solvents such as water and alcohols, which is characteristic of many amino acid derivatives. It exhibits basic properties due to the presence of the amino group, allowing it to participate in various chemical reactions, including peptide bond formation. This compound may be utilized in biochemical research, particularly in the synthesis of peptides and as a building block in drug development. Additionally, its structural features may impart specific biological activities,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ry. Formula:C9H19NO2
InChI:InChI=1/C9H19NO2/c1-2-12-9(11)7-5-3-4-6-8-10/h2-8,10H2,1H3
InChI key:InChIKey=VBPPJUXIEMSWDT-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(CCCCCCN)(OCC)=O
